mirror of
https://github.com/HarbourMasters/Starship.git
synced 2025-01-23 21:45:00 +03:00
sf_i6_2 decompiled (#104)
* sf_i6_2 * use macro * suggestion macros Co-authored-by: petrie911 <69443847+petrie911@users.noreply.github.com> * decimal suggestion Co-authored-by: petrie911 <69443847+petrie911@users.noreply.github.com> * file rename --------- Co-authored-by: petrie911 <69443847+petrie911@users.noreply.github.com>
This commit is contained in:
parent
119dfa9354
commit
8f794a6335
@ -46,6 +46,7 @@ void func_8001D1C8(u8, u32);
|
||||
void func_8001D2FC(f32 *, u16);
|
||||
void func_8001D3A0(f32 *, u16);
|
||||
void func_8001D400(s8);
|
||||
void func_8001D410(s32);
|
||||
void func_8001D444(u8, u16, u8, u8);
|
||||
void func_8001D4AC(u16, u8, u8, u8);
|
||||
void func_8001D520(void);
|
||||
@ -111,6 +112,7 @@ void func_8002E700(Player *);
|
||||
void func_8002EE64(Actor * actor);
|
||||
void func_8002F180(void);
|
||||
void func_8002F5F4(u16* msg, RadioCharacterId character);
|
||||
void func_8002F69C(Actor*);
|
||||
void func_8003088C(Actor*);
|
||||
void func_800319AC(Actor* this);
|
||||
void func_80035448(Actor* actor);
|
||||
|
@ -137,6 +137,8 @@ D_i5_801BE2A4 = 0x801BE2A4;
|
||||
func_i6_801888F4 = 0x801888F4;
|
||||
func_i6_80197CC4 = 0x80197CC4;
|
||||
func_i6_8018D16C = 0x8018D16C;
|
||||
D_i6_801A68B0 = 0x801A68B0;//size:0x48 type:Vec3f segment:ovl_i6
|
||||
D_i6_801A68F8 = 0x801A68F8;//size:0xC type:f32 segment:ovl_i6
|
||||
D_i6_801A7F30 = 0x801A7F30;
|
||||
D_i6_801A7F58 = 0x801A7F58;
|
||||
D_i6_801A7F60 = 0x801A7F60;
|
||||
|
4122
src/overlays/ovl_i6/fox_andross.c
Normal file
4122
src/overlays/ovl_i6/fox_andross.c
Normal file
File diff suppressed because it is too large
Load Diff
File diff suppressed because it is too large
Load Diff
@ -1,17 +0,0 @@
|
||||
#include "common.h"
|
||||
|
||||
#pragma GLOBAL_ASM("asm/us/nonmatchings/overlays/ovl_i6/sf_i6_2/func_i6_80196210.s")
|
||||
|
||||
#pragma GLOBAL_ASM("asm/us/nonmatchings/overlays/ovl_i6/sf_i6_2/func_i6_8019624C.s")
|
||||
|
||||
#pragma GLOBAL_ASM("asm/us/nonmatchings/overlays/ovl_i6/sf_i6_2/func_i6_80196288.s")
|
||||
|
||||
#pragma GLOBAL_ASM("asm/us/nonmatchings/overlays/ovl_i6/sf_i6_2/func_i6_801962F4.s")
|
||||
|
||||
#pragma GLOBAL_ASM("asm/us/nonmatchings/overlays/ovl_i6/sf_i6_2/func_i6_80196314.s")
|
||||
|
||||
#pragma GLOBAL_ASM("asm/us/nonmatchings/overlays/ovl_i6/sf_i6_2/func_i6_80196968.s")
|
||||
|
||||
#pragma GLOBAL_ASM("asm/us/nonmatchings/overlays/ovl_i6/sf_i6_2/func_i6_80196BF8.s")
|
||||
|
||||
#pragma GLOBAL_ASM("asm/us/nonmatchings/overlays/ovl_i6/sf_i6_2/func_i6_80196D88.s")
|
@ -140,22 +140,22 @@
|
||||
symbol_name_format: i6_$VRAM
|
||||
subsegments:
|
||||
- [0xE9F1D0, c, fox_i6]
|
||||
- [0xE9F1E0, c, fox_ve2]
|
||||
- [0xEADEC0, c, sf_i6_2]
|
||||
- [0xE9F1E0, c, fox_andross]
|
||||
- [0xEADEC0, c, fox_ve2]
|
||||
- [0xEAF7E0, c, fox_sy]
|
||||
- [0xEBD210, c, sf_i6_4]
|
||||
- [0xEBE400, .data, fox_i6]
|
||||
- [0xEBE410, .data, fox_ve2]
|
||||
- [0xEBE560, data, sf_i6_2]
|
||||
- [0xEBE410, .data, fox_andross]
|
||||
- [0xEBE560, .data, fox_ve2]
|
||||
- [0xEBE5C0, data, fox_sy]
|
||||
- [0xEBE830, data, sf_i6_4]
|
||||
- [0xEBE840, .rodata, fox_i6]
|
||||
- [0xEBE850, .rodata, fox_ve2]
|
||||
- [0xEBF0F0, .rodata, sf_i6_2]
|
||||
- [0xEBE850, .rodata, fox_andross]
|
||||
- [0xEBF0F0, .rodata, fox_ve2]
|
||||
- [0xEBF130, .rodata, fox_sy]
|
||||
- [0xEBFB80, .rodata, sf_i6_4]
|
||||
- { start: 0xEBFBE0, type: .bss, vram: 0x801A7F30, name: fox_i6 }
|
||||
- { type: .bss, vram: 0x801A7F40, name: fox_ve2 }
|
||||
- { type: .bss, vram: 0x801A7F40, name: fox_andross }
|
||||
- { type: bss, vram: 0x801A8440, name: fox_sy }
|
||||
|
||||
- name: ovl_menu
|
||||
|
Loading…
Reference in New Issue
Block a user